  8. Caught my first bed fish earlier today, and it was really an amazing experience. Observing the behavioral habits of a springtime bass is intensely interesting to me. I worked her for 30 minutes and watched her slowly get more and more aggressive until she violently ate my creature bait. I got her back in the water quickly and handled her with care. From an ethical standpoint I believe its all about how you handle a fish once it is caught, so my conscience is clean!

  20. Innsbrook has a few nice looking ponds. Only had the pleasure of fishing one briefly, so I can’t speak for their productivity. Also, google maps is a really good way to identify ponds! Turn on earth view to get a feel for if the banks look fishable or not, as well as parking. Get some good ones, it’s a great time of year for it!
